Part Overview

The SMBJ58CAHM3_A/I is a bidirectional transient voltage suppressor (TVS) diode from Vishay General Semiconductor - Diodes Division, designed for telecom applications requiring transient protection. This component operates with a 58V reverse standoff voltage and provides 93.6V maximum clamping voltage at peak pulse current of 6.4A, delivering 600W peak pulse power dissipation in a surface mount DO-214AA (SMB) package.

The SMBJ58CAHM3_A/I carries an obsolete product status. Identifying equivalent substitute parts ensures design continuity and supply chain reliability for applications requiring this specific electrical and mechanical configuration.

Key Parameters

Parameter Value
Voltage - Reverse Standoff (Typ) 58V
Voltage - Breakdown (Min) 64.4V
Voltage - Clamping (Max) @ Ipp 93.6V
Current - Peak Pulse (10/1000µs) 6.4A
Power - Peak Pulse 600W
Bidirectional Channels 1
Operating Temperature Range -55°C to 150°C (TJ)
Package / Case DO-214AA (SMB)
Mounting Type Surface Mount
Grade Automotive
Qualification AEC-Q101
RoHS Status ROHS3 Compliant

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The SMBJ58CAHM3_B/I is the direct substitute for SMBJ58CAHM3_A/I. Both components maintain identical electrical specifications, automotive-grade qualification, and AEC-Q101 certification. The transition from obsolete to active product status makes SMBJ58CAHM3_B/I the preferred selection for new designs and ongoing production requirements.

The packaging format difference (bulk versus Tape & Reel) reflects standard industry practice for active versus legacy product lines and does not affect electrical performance or mechanical compatibility in surface mount applications.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can SMBJ58CAHM3_B/I be used as a direct replacement for SMBJ58CAHM3_A/I?

A: Yes. Both parts share identical electrical parameters, including reverse standoff voltage, clamping voltage, peak pulse current, and power dissipation. Both are packaged in DO-214AA (SMB) and meet automotive AEC-Q101 qualification requirements.

Q: What is the difference between the two part numbers?

A: The primary difference is product status and packaging format. SMBJ58CAHM3_A/I is obsolete and supplied in bulk packaging, while SMBJ58CAHM3_B/I is active and supplied in Tape & Reel format. Electrical and mechanical specifications are identical.

Q: Are there any compatibility concerns with PCB assembly?

A: No. Both components use the same DO-214AA (SMB) surface mount package with identical footprint and soldering requirements. PCB designs do not require modification.

Q: Does the Tape & Reel packaging affect component performance?

A: No. Tape & Reel packaging is a standard format for active production components and does not impact electrical performance, reliability, or operating characteristics.

Q: Are both parts RoHS and REACH compliant?

A: Yes. Both SMBJ58CAHM3_A/I and SMBJ58CAHM3_B/I are ROHS3 compliant and REACH unaffected.
